Abstract: | This paper explores patterns of governance in transnational development non-governmental organisation (NGO) coalitions. Governance is a term that has increased in usage during the last decade; it has been used in a variety of ways, by a variety of actors. Here, governance is broken down into two elements—governance as a purposive activity, and governance as an explanatory framework. This is an empirically grounded paper which focuses on the mechanisms of governance as a purposive activity, illustrated by interviews with four transnational development NGO coalitions. The principal aim of this research is to illustrate the workings and mechanics of governance. |
